Agram of the 19th and 20th centuries – little Vienna

A tour that will teach you more than just history and architecture.

In the middle of historicism and secession architecture, among the numerous attractions in Zagreb city centre that reveal its rich history, you will find a true urban jewel called the Green Horseshoe (Zelena potkova). Austro-Hungarian charm of these parks and gardens, shaped like the letter U, influenced Zagrebian identity which is present to this day. This is why you will learn more than just the history and architecture on this tour – you will get to know that what truly makes a city: its residents and their view of life.
